Bill Kline on July 3, 2018 at 11:25 am in terms of I'm sure- and in my practical experience- the colder the higher In terms of VBs. the massive trick to VBs is utilizing them when It's not necessarily so chilly and/or Once your action is substantial. I’d say you are right any time you say “for the reason that as significantly my knowledge, VBL not allowing the moisture to go through”, although not appropriate using this type of aspect: ” it will build issue at temperatures under -30 or -40 degree celsius.”. I’d say which the colder it is outside the house, the more likely itis the down inside your sleeping bag or other insulation will probably be under the dew level, as well as the greater possible The body vapor is usually to condense to liquid within your insulation and even freeze sound, wiping out your loft.

in the course of my Ultralight during the country’s Icebox hike, I used to be joined for a night by Backpacking gentle staffer Sam Haraldson, whose clothes and equipment technique lacked VBL. right after climbing for several hrs, Sam eliminated his water-proof-breathable jacket to discover a layer of frost inside of it, because of his perspiration turning from vapor into water mainly because it reached the dew place, which was inside of his clothes method.
